A major aspect of the HCALL is that it allows retireving _several_ counters at once (unlike regular PMCs, which are read one at a time). By reading several counters at once, we can get a more consistent snapshot of the system. This patchset extends the transaction interface to accomplish submitting several events to the PMU and have the PMU read them all at once. User is expected to submit the set of events they want to read as an "event group". In the kernel, we submit each event to the PMU using the following logic (from Peter Zijlstra). pmu->start_txn(pmu, PMU_TXN_READ); leader->read(); for_each_sibling() sibling->read(); pmu->commit_txn(); where: - the ->read()s queue events to be submitted to the hypervisor, and, - the ->commit_txn() issues the HCALL, retrieves the result and updates the event count. Architectures/PMUs that don't need/implement PMU_TXN_READ type of transactions, simply ignore the ->start_txn() and ->commit_txn() and continue to read the counters one at a time in the ->read() call.
